I seek leave to cast a vote against the National Animal Identification and Tracing Bill, which came through at about 90 miles an hour and I did not hear it.

πŸ—£οΈ Speech Lindsay Tisch (New Zealand National Party β€” Member for Waikato)
Time unknown

Well, noβ€”the opportunity was there, and it is up to the member toβ€”

πŸ’¬ Hon John Banks: But I am seeking leave.

The ASSISTANT SPEAKER (Lindsay Tisch): We have already done that. It is too late because I have announced the result. We have actually voted on it, and we now move to the next section, which is moving into Committee stage. I say sorry to the member, but the member must exercise his right to vote at the time or bring up a point of order at the time, not after. The House has decided, we have passed that, and we are now moving into Committee.
